Prep and Cook Time

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 15 minutes
Total Time: 25 minutes

Yield

Approximately 4 servings (about 1 cup each)

Difficulty Level

Easy – perfect for busy cooks and beginners alike

Ingredients

  • 1 cup canned coconut milk (full fat for creaminess)
  • 1 medium ripe avocado, peeled and pitted
  • 2 tbsp tahini made from sesame seeds (nut-free)
  • 2 tbsp fresh lemon juice
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tbsp nutritional yeast (adds umami and depth)
  • 1/2 tsp smoked paprika
  • Salt to taste
  • Freshly ground black pepper to taste
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h cilantro (optional for garnish)

Instructions

  1. Blend the base: In a food processor or high-speed blender, combine the coconut milk, avocado, and tahini. Blend until smooth and creamy, about 1-2 minutes. This creates the luscious, nut-free creamy foundation of your sauce.
  2. Add the acidic notes: Add the freshly squeezed lemon juice, garlic, and nutritional yeast. Blend again until well incorporated. Nutritional yeast adds a subtle cheesy depth without dairy or nuts.
  3. Season carefully: Stir in the smoked paprika, salt, and black pepper. Taste and adjust seasoning as needed. For a smoky kick, feel free to add an extra pinch of smoked paprika.
  4. Chill for melding: Transfer the sauce to a bowl, cover tightly, and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es. This step helps flavors blend beautifully and thickens the sauce slightly.
  5. Garnish and serve: Just before serving, sprinkle chopped fresh cilantro on top for a fresh herbal note and vibrant color contrast.

Chef’s Notes

  • You can substitute coconut milk with oat or soy milk for a lower-fat version, but expect a slightly thinner texture.
  • Tahini is naturally nut-free as it’s made from sesame seeds-check labels to avoid cross-contamination if allergies are severe.
  • For a spicy twist, add 1/4 tsp cayenne pepper or a dash of hot sauce to punch up the heat.
  • Make ahead and store in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days-stir gently before serving.
  • To balance thickness, add water a tablespoon at a time if your sauce becomes too dense after chilling.

Serving Suggestions

This versatile nut-free vegan sauce pairs exquisitely with roasted vegetables, grilled tofu, or as a creamy dressing for fresh salads. It makes an exceptional dip for crisp crudités and works wonders drizzled over warm grain bowls. For visual appeal, garnish with extra cilantro leaves or a dusting of smoked paprika. Serve chilled or at room temperature to showcase the sauce’s silky essence.

Q&A

Q&A: Nut-Free Vegan Sauces – Flavorful, Allergy-Friendly Picks

Q1: Why choose nut-free vegan sauces?
A1: Nut-free vegan sauces open up a tasty world of plant-based options for those with nut allergies or sensitivities. They’re perfect for anyone wanting to enjoy rich, creamy, and flavorful sauces without the risk of allergic reactions, making meals inclusive and safe.

Q2: What are some common ingredients in nut-free vegan sauces?
A2: Nut-free vegan sauces often lean on ingredients like seeds (sunflower, hemp), coconut milk, soy-based products, avocados, roasted vegetables, and blended legumes. These provide creaminess and depth without relying on nuts.

Q3: Can I get creamy textures without nuts?
A3: Absolutely! Creaminess can come from soaked sunflower seeds, creamy coconut milk, silken tofu, or blended white beans. These alternatives offer luscious textures that rival traditional nut-based sauces.

Q4: Are nut-free vegan sauces versatile in cooking?
A4: Definitely. From tangy salad dressings and zesty dips to decadent pasta sauces and glazes, nut-free vegan sauces can elevate any dish while catering to nut allergies and plant-based diets alike.

Q5: How can I add bold flavor to nut-free vegan sauces?
A5: Bold flavors come from fresh herbs, spices, fermented ingredients like miso or tamari, nutritional yeast for a cheesy note, garlic, lemon juice, and roasted veggies. Combining these elements ensures your sauces burst with deliciousness.

Q6: Where can I find recipes or inspiration for nut-free vegan sauces?
A6: Many food blogs, vegan cookbooks, and allergy-friendly cooking websites offer fantastic nut-free vegan sauce recipes. Experimenting with basic sauces and customizing them with favorite flavors is also a great way to craft personalized, allergy-safe delights.

Q7: Can nut-free vegan sauces cater to other dietary needs?
A7: Yes! Many nut-free vegan sauces are naturally gluten-free, soy-free (depending on ingredients), and free from common allergens beyond nuts. Always read labels or choose homemade options to ensure they meet your specific dietary restrictions.
